#291bb8 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#291bb8 is composed of 16.1% red, 10.6% green and 72.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 77.7% cyan, 85.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 27.8% black. It has a hue angle of 245.4 degrees, a saturation of 74.4% and a lightness of 41.4%. #291bb8 color hex could be obtained by blending #5236ff with #000071. Closest websafe color is: #3333cc.

Shades and Tints of #291bb8

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#03020d is the darkest color, while #fbfbfe is the lightest one.
